Lil’ Kim was convicted on Thursday on one count of conspiracy and three counts of perjury for lying to a federal grand jury about a 2001 shootout outside of New York radio station Hot 97. She was acquitted of the most serious charge, obstruction of justice, which carried a maximum ten-year prison sentence.http://www.cnn.com/2005/LAW/03/17/lilkim.convicted.reut/index.html
